Output 29937c0235a20f07b6bd20ecfd5e379e84320e848e4d79f3a75822f7111ec850:0

value
1321647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66501105ac9ce590e5e7fdde07e053424119da50 OP_EQUAL
address
3B1zmEAvyNBPkDZ7BvpNuzqkw8E8igqcbB
transaction
29937c0235a20f07b6bd20ecfd5e379e84320e848e4d79f3a75822f7111ec850
spent
true